For dvd-r I use Pioneer, A105-4x & A104-2x, these are older models so 
the models numbers may be different today. The Sony 500x gets good 
reviews, from users. I have a scsi dvd burner, quite expensive, you 
need a compelling reason to go this route, my IDE model works as well 
for me.
